Method and system for three-dimensional print oriented image segmentation
A system and method for converting imaging data, for example, medical imaging data, to three-dimensional printer data. Imaging data may be received describing for example a three-dimensional volume of a subject or patient. Using printer definition data describing a particular printer, 3D printer input data may be created from the imaging data describing at least part of the three-dimensional volume.
1. A method for converting creating three-dimensional (3D) objects, the method comprising:
receiving imaging data describing a three-dimensional volume;
segmenting the imaging data to produce one or more three-dimensional masks, each three-dimensional mask comprising a three-dimensional matrix indicating where material should be printed and where material is not printed;
using data describing a particular printer, evaluating the one or more three-dimensional masks for printability;
if the evaluation determines the one or more masks are not printable, adjusting the one or more three-dimensional masks and repeating the evaluating operation; and
if the evaluation determines the one or more three-dimensional masks are printable, creating data to be input to a printer for printing the objects.
